The Delhi High Court on Monday issued notice to the British Broadcasting Corporation (BBC) based on a defamation suit moved by a Gujarat-based non-government organisation (NGO).
A defamation suit has been moved by Gujarat based Non-Government Organisation (NGO) against BBC claiming that its two-part documentary on Prime Minister Narender Modi cast a slur on the reputation of India and its judiciary as well as Prime Minister Modi.
